Province Cilicia
Region Lycaonia
City Isaura
Reign Septimius Severus
Person (obv.) Caracalla (Augustus)
Obverse inscription ΑΥ Κ Μ ΑΥ ΑΝΤΩΝΙΝΟϹ
Edition Αὐ(τοκράτωρ) Κ(αῖσαρ) Μ(ᾶρκος) Αὐ(ρήλιος) Ἀντωνῖνος
Translation Emperor Caesar Marcus Aurelius Antoninus
Obverse design laureate and cuirassed bust of Caracalla, right, seen from front, with gorgoneion and balteus on cuirass
Reverse inscription ΜΗΤΡΟΠΟΛΕΩϹ ΙϹΑΥΡΩΝ
Edition Μητροπόλεως Ἰσαύρων
Translation metropolis of the Isaurians
Reverse design Lycaon (?), laureate and in military dress, advancing right, holding sceptre and clasping hand with Apollo standing left, holding laurel branch; between, wolf seated right, head left, carrying human hand in its mouth
Metal copper-based alloy
Average diameter 26 mm
Average weight 8.49 g
Axis 6, 7, 12
Specimens 18 (8 in the core collections)
